How to fill out the Fhog Vic Form online

Filling out the Fhog Vic Form online is a crucial step towards obtaining the First Home Owner Grant. This guide will help you navigate through each section of the form with clarity and confidence.

Follow the steps to successfully complete the Fhog Vic Form online.

  1. Click 'Get Form' button to acquire the Fhog Vic Form and open it for editing.
  2. Begin with Section 1, where you will answer eligibility questions. Ensure you respond truthfully to each question to determine if you qualify for the grant.
  3. Moving to Section 2, provide details for all applicants. This section requires full names, contact information, and residential addresses.
  4. In Section 3, if applicable, fill in the details of any spouse or partner not listed as an applicant. Make sure to include their personal information as required.
  5. In Section 4, carefully enter the property and transaction details. This includes the address, transaction type, and relevant dates.
  6. Section 5 is where you provide payment details. Include your bank information if you are applying directly with the SRO.
  7. Sign the declaration in Section 6. Both applicants must affirm that the information provided is accurate.
  8. If applicable, complete Section 7 for the spouse or partner's declaration.
  9. Finally, refer to Section 8 to ensure all required supporting documents are attached. Review the checklist to avoid delays in processing.
